Tracking Yorkshire's Dinosaurs
Join me in Scarbados this summer as we go in search of Yorkshire's Jurassic dinosaurs!

More than 165 million years ago, in the middle of the Jurassic period, dinosaurs roamed Yorkshire. How do we know this? Because we find their footprints, fossilized in the Jurassic rocks of the Yorkshire Coast. One of the best places to see them is Scarborough's South Bay, and on this dinosaur-hunting trip, I will show you how to find them.

As we head towards the Jurassic rocks of South Cliff, we'll have a go at walking like dinosaurs, and making our own tracks in the sand.

Once we reach South Cliff, I will explain how to read the rocks, and what they can tell us about Jurassic Yorkshire. This includes learning how to spot the impressions of giant extinct reptiles. Once you've got your eye in, you'll soon be stomping with stegosaurs, sauntering with sauropods, and thundering with theropods!
